Hamilton Beach Single Serve Coffee Maker Not Working
Hamilton Beach is a popular brand known for producing quality coffee makers. However, even the best coffee makers can stop working at some point. If you own a Hamilton Beach Single Serve Coffee Maker and it's not working, there are a few things you can do to troubleshoot the problem.
Check the Power Source
The first thing you should do is check the power source. Make sure the coffee maker is plugged in and the outlet is working. If the outlet is not working, try plugging the coffee maker into a different outlet. If the coffee maker still doesn't work, move on to the next step.
Clean the Coffee Maker
If the power source is not the issue, the next step is to clean the coffee maker. Over time, mineral deposits can build up inside the coffee maker and cause it to stop working. To clean the coffee maker, fill the water reservoir with equal parts water and vinegar and run it through a brewing cycle. Repeat this process with just water to rinse out any remaining vinegar.
Check the Water Reservoir
If the coffee maker is still not working, check the water reservoir. Make sure it is filled with water and that the lid is securely in place. If the water reservoir is empty or the lid is not securely in place, the coffee maker will not work.
Check the Coffee Pod
If the water reservoir is not the issue, check the coffee pod. Make sure it is the correct size and that it is inserted correctly. If the coffee pod is not the correct size or it is not inserted correctly, the coffee maker will not work.
Reset the Coffee Maker
If none of the above steps work, try resetting the coffee maker. Unplug it from the power source and wait a few minutes before plugging it back in. This can sometimes reset the coffee maker and get it working again.
